About Gateway and WANRack:
St. Louis-based Gateway Fiber and Kansas City-based WANRack have merged to create a national fiber-to-the-premises (FTTP) platform serving residents, businesses, and schools across 25 U.S. states. Gateway Fiber, founded in 2019, provides high-speed internet to residential and commercial customers across Missouri, Massachusetts, and Minnesota. WANRack, launched in 2013, is a broadband provider that serves school districts and libraries through its E-Rate program, as well as residential and commercial customers in eastern Kansas via its KWIKOM subsidiary.
The merger combines the resources of both companies, resulting in greater scale, improved operations, and enhanced growth opportunities for employees and the organization. The combined company is expanding its product offerings for small and medium-sized businesses while addressing increasing commercial and wholesale internet needs.

Engineering Sales Representatives will have responsibilities for providing technical and application assistance to engineering consultants to influence their design and specification requirements; developing and managing sales plans to increase sales effectiveness and sustain sales growth; developing new business along with maintaining and further developing existing business partners; promoting manufacturers' visits with strategically important customers and business partners; attending trade shows, product shows, and industry functions as required to keep informed on activities and changes in the building HVAC marketplace.
RESPONSIBILITIES
Responsibilities include sizing, selecting, and designing mechanical and HVAC equipment for engineers such as custom air handling units, packaged rooftop equipment, dehumidification systems, Dedicated Outdoor Air Systems (DOAS), chiller systems, air distribution/ventilation systems including grilles, registers and diffusers, laboratory exhaust and controls systems, clean room air filtration, dust collection systems, and variable frequency drives.
Candidate must enjoy promoting products, developing customer relationships, and being known for product expertise.
Support engineers with equipment selections for systems, prepare quotes, and sell equipment to owners and contractors.
